How Pasture Respond to Dry Conditions

An Alberta Agriculture specialist says one of the keys to good pasture management to have a solid understanding of the ways plants respond to dry conditions. Andrea Hanson, beef extension specialist, joins us on the line with more.

Many Canadian grazing recommendations were developed using beef cattle in the prairies. While we have adapted these the forage species and climate in Ontario, other livestock have different needs. Public enemy number one for grazing sheep are gastrointestinal parasites.

The purpose of the Profitable Pasture conference is to bring fresh ideas and new research results to Ontario grazing managers across the ruminant livestock sectors. These conferences have a major focus on pasture management.
